St Louis religious leader Robert Carlson pens letter raising concern over group’s support for contraception,abortion and role models like Gloria SteinemSpare a thought for the Catholics of St Louis, Missouri, and weighed down as they are with ponderous spiritual things. On top of such weighty issues as the pope’s recent call for an end to the death penalty – a favorite pastime in Missouri – they must now wrestle with a new moral conundrum: Girl Scout cookies.
The ethical dilemma is assign pithily on the website of the archdiocese of St Louis under the headline: “Can I still buy Girl Scout cookies?” The equally punchy reply states: “Each person must act in accord with their conscience.Continue reading...
